2015-11-24 3 views
0

Я пытаюсь добавить случайное число Math.floor ((Math.random() * 10000) + 1);Добавить случайное число в URL-адрес в скрипте

Для встроенного Formstack формы, такие, как этот:

<script type="text/javascript" src="https://brynhowlett.formstack.com/forms/js.php/starbucks_orders__copy&"></script> 

Int должен идти в конце сразу после «&». У меня почти было это, но продолжал испортить. Мне просто нужно толчок в правильном направлении.

Также мне нужно, чтобы все было встроено. Поэтому, я думаю, я бы добавил следующее выше вложенную форму.

<script type="text/javascript" 

JS здесь идет

</script> 
+0

Можете ли вы дать нам какой-то код, пожалуйста, и дайте использовать больше объяснений? –

+0

Извините, просто забыл поставить 4 пробела перед html – BHCOM

+0

Спасибо за ваше время – BHCOM

ответ

2

Попробуйте использовать document.open(), document.write(), document.close()

<script> 
 
    document.open(); 
 
    document.write("<script src=https://brynhowlett.formstack.com/forms/js.php/starbucks_orders__copy&" + Math.floor((Math.random() * 10000) + 1) + "><\/script>"); 
 
    document.close(); 
 
</script> 
 
<body> 
 
</body>

+0

Я не думаю, что это потому, что это вытащили прямо из w3schools.com – BHCOM

+0

http://www.w3schools.com/jsref/jsref_random.asp – BHCOM

+0

Спасибо, что помогли. – BHCOM